Clock Out

The Clock Out jack outputs the clock per sequencer as set by Speed or incoming clock. You can use one clock source for multiple sequencers by daisy chaining the Clock Out to the other Sequencer’s Clock In. CV Out

The CV Out is the output of the sequencers. It outputs 2V, 5V or 9V as set with the Output Range slide switches. The output can be quantized with the Quantizers, effectively giving you a range up to 9 Octaves. The output is also affected by the Transpose In.

CV Recorder Bank Up/Down

Send a trigger (+5V) at these inputs to move the selected bank one position up or down. This only affects banks 1-3. You can, for example, use the SOS Out (Start of Sequence Output) and EOS OUT (End of Sequence Output).  

CV Recorder Clock In

The incoming clock signal to the CV Recorder Clock In sets the speed of the record and playback of the central CV Recorder. One positive pulse steps the CV Recorder one step.

CV Recorder CV In

The CV Recorder CV Input receives control voltage to be recorded to the selected CV Recorder bank (1, 2 or 3) via the Set control.

CV Recorder CV Out

The CV Recorder CV Out outputs the corresponding CV passing through the CV Recorder CV In or the output of what is recorded in CV Recorder Banks 1, 2 or 3.

CV Recorder Start

When this input receives a positive pulse, the CV Recorder begins playback on the selected bank.
